Closed Bug 1829366 Opened 2 years ago Closed 2 years ago

Downloading PDFs is unintuitive on android

Categories

(Firefox :: PDF Viewer, defect, P1)

All
Android
defect

Tracking

()

VERIFIED FIXED
114 Branch
Tracking Status
firefox113 --- verified
firefox114 --- verified

People

(Reporter: marco, Assigned: calixte)

References

Details

Attachments

(4 files)

+++ This bug was initially created as a clone of Bug #1823164 +++

We have decided on a slightly different solution to bug 1823164.

Assignee: nobody → cdenizet
Severity: -- → S3
Status: NEW → ASSIGNED
Priority: -- → P1
Depends on: 1829638

Comment on attachment 9330026 [details]
Bug 1829366 - Add a toolbar with a download button in pdf.js in GeckoView r=#pdfjs-reviewers,#geckoview-reviewers

Beta/Release Uplift Approval Request

  • User impact if declined: The way to download a pdf on Fenix is not really user-friendly right now and this patch will help to make it a way better.
  • Is this code covered by automated tests?: No
  • Has the fix been verified in Nightly?: No
  • Needs manual test from QE?: Yes
  • If yes, steps to reproduce: - check that there's a toolbar with a Download button on the top of the pdf viewer
  • open a pdf in Fenix
  • tap the button "Download" and the pdf should be saved in the Downloads folder on the device
  • List of other uplifts needed: None
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): It's a small change.
    The toolbar itself has been introduced in nightly few days ago with no specific issues and we just changed the css today to make more friendly with the help UI/UX team.
  • String changes made/needed:
  • Is Android affected?: Yes
Attachment #9330026 - Flags: approval-mozilla-beta?
Attachment #9329975 - Flags: approval-mozilla-beta?
Pushed by cdenizet@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/734186ff0bc5 Enable the new PDF.js toolbar on GeckoView r=geckoview-reviewers,amejiamarmol
See Also: → 1823164
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→ 114 Branch

Comment on attachment 9329975 [details]
Bug 1829366 - Enable the new PDF.js toolbar on GeckoView r=#geckoview-reviewers

Approved for 113.0b8.

Attachment #9329975 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Attachment #9330026 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Flags: qe-verify+

Verified as fixed on Nightly 114.0a1 and Beta 113.0b8.
Devices used:

Oneplus 5 (Android 10)
OnePlus A3000 (Android 6)
Lenovo Tab P11 Plus (Android 12)
Lenovo tab M10 (Android 10)
Xiaomi 12 Pro (Android 13)
Huawei MediaPad M2 (Android 5.1.1)
Google Pixel 7 (Android 13)

Status: RESOLVED → VERIFIED
Flags: qe-verify+

:Adina, could you check that it's fine with a device with a low-resolution screen ?

Flags: needinfo?(apetridean)

:Calixte, we've also checked this issue on devices with low-resolution screens using the latest Nightly 114.0a1 from 26.04.2023 and Firefox 113.0b8.

Devices used:
Xperia 10 (Android 12)
Samsung Galaxy S9 (Android 8)
OnePlus A3000 (Android 6)

Flags: needinfo?(apetridean)
See Also: → 1824657
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: